Types of professional indemnity insurance
There are several primary types of professional indemnity insurance relevant to engineering consulting, each offering tailored coverage options. Understanding these types helps firms select appropriate protection against legal claims. Common categories include:
-
Standard Professional Indemnity Insurance: Provides broad coverage for claims arising from professional mistakes, negligence, or errors in the engineering services provided. It is essential for legal compliance and risk management.
-
Project-Specific Insurance: Offers coverage for particular projects or contracts, addressing unique risks associated with complex or high-value assignments. This type ensures targeted protection during critical project phases.
-
Extended or Enhanced Coverage: Supplements basic policies with additional protections such as cyber liability, intellectual property infringement, or contractual disputes. It is suitable for firms seeking comprehensive legal risk mitigation.
-
Occurrence vs. Claims-Made Policies: Occurrence policies cover incidents occurring during the policy period, regardless of claim timing. Claims-made policies only respond to claims filed within the policy period, influencing coverage scope and cost.
Selecting appropriate types of professional indemnity insurance is vital for engineering firms aiming to manage legal liabilities effectively. Careful assessment of project risks and legal obligations guides optimal policy choices.

Dispute Resolution Mechanisms for Engineering Consulting Projects
Dispute resolution mechanisms are vital to managing conflicts that can arise during engineering consulting projects. They provide structured methods for addressing disagreements efficiently, minimizing project delays and legal risks. Effective mechanisms promote transparent communication and preserve professional relationships.
Negotiation is often the first step in dispute resolution, allowing parties to reach mutually acceptable solutions informally. When negotiations fail, mediation offers a neutral third-party facilitator to help reconcile differing interests. Mediation is cost-effective and maintains confidentiality, making it a preferred option.
If mediation does not result in a settlement, arbitration serves as a formal alternative to litigation. It involves binding decisions made by an impartial arbitrator, often respecting contractual agreements. Arbitration is generally quicker and more flexible than court proceedings. Litigation remains a last resort, involving judicial proceedings that can be time-consuming and costly.
Choosing the appropriate dispute resolution mechanism depends on project specifics, contractual clauses, and jurisdictional considerations. Incorporating clear dispute resolution clauses in contractual documents ensures parties understand the process upfront. This proactive approach can significantly mitigate the potential impact of legal disputes in engineering consulting projects.
